The Faculty of Business, Economics, and Accountancy (FBEA) 麻豆视频 (UMS) concluded a remarkable 2024 by participating in the Global Convergence Capstone Design Programme held at Hannam University, South Korea.

With the theme 鈥淐arbon Neutrality,鈥 the program emphasized academic excellence, industry engagement, and cultural exchange.

The UMS delegation, led by the Head of International Mobility Programme, Datu Razali Datu Eranza, included FPEP Senior Deputy Registrar, Awina Kamis; Head of International Business Programme, Dr. Nur Aleysa Chew Tze Cheng; and FPEP staff member, Arnah Sanuddin.

They were warmly welcomed by LINC 3.0 Project Director, Prof. Gu-Hwan Won, who underscored the importance of global collaboration in education during their meeting.

More than 25 participants from UMS and Hannam University took part in the program, which featured various lectures on carbon neutrality and global business trends. Highlights included Datu Razali鈥檚 talk on 鈥淔uture-Proofing Workplaces: Carbon Neutrality and Global HR Trends,鈥 Prof. Chen Hong鈥檚 lecture on 鈥淓xport and Import,鈥 and Dr. Nur Aleysa鈥檚 presentation on 鈥淐arbon Neutrality in International Business.鈥

The program also included industrial visits to innovative Small and Medium Enterprises such as PumpCare, which focuses on sustainable energy operations; Water Genesis; and the Daejeon City Subway Organization, offering participants insights into sustainable practices and the latest technologies.

Additionally, participants joined Korean cultural workshops, traditional food-making activities, and the 鈥淪abah-Daejeon Cultural Night,鈥 which fostered closer ties between the two institutions.

The program concluded with special lectures by JeuD茅rm CEO, Tatyana Jeon and Professor Dr. Gilbert M. Tumibay from Woosong University.

Meanwhile, FPEP Dean, Assoc. Prof. Dr. Mohd Rahimie Abd Karim, expressed gratitude to Hannam University for organizing the program.

He also commended the efforts of key contributors, including FPEP lecturers Assoc. Prof. Mat Salleh Ayub and Datu Razali, as well as Hannam University鈥檚 Prof. Peter Lee, for their collaboration and commitment to the program鈥檚 success.

鈥淭his program not only addresses global issues like carbon neutrality but also builds strong academic and cultural bridges.

鈥淚t also reflects FPEP鈥檚 dedication to advancing global academic excellence,鈥 Rahimie said.

In other developments, FPEP was once again recognized as the recipient of the Most Active Mobility Programme Award for the eighth consecutive year, while Prof. Peter Lee received a special commendation from South Korea鈥檚 Ministry of Education for his contributions to international academic collaboration.
